Guest guest Posted January 9, 2006 Report Share Posted January 9, 2006 Whew! The thought of making these *firestarters* worries the heck out of me. Wax is dangerously combustive and so is dryer lint. Just hope everyone knew that and kept everything away from an open flame. I am so very careful even with bee's wax( using a double broiler.) However I have dipped wood matches in melted wax to make them water proof for fire starting. But I was very careful melting the wax in a double broiler. A safer method is to take a candle along with you camping and shave off a few pieces to use as a fire starter. Happy camping..
